## Ownership — Query Planner Regression

Since the Marrowbase 4.2 upgrade, certain join-heavy queries in the reporting path pick a nested-loop plan and run roughly 20x slower. A planner hint is in place as a stopgap; do not remove it. On-call: if query latency alerts fire on the reporting replicas, check the hint is still applied before anything else. The regression and its permanent fix are owned by the engineer named below.

named custodian: Oliath Ralax

## ChipGate Reader Firmware — Release Step 4

Before publishing your plugin for the ChipGate Mk3 timing-chip reader, confirm that your build targets the Velodyne Loop race profile and passes the antenna self-test suite. Plugins that modify split-time aggregation must be reviewed by the Trailforge integrations team prior to signing. Once your artifact is reproducible and checksummed, submit it to the staging relay in Kestrel Park. Sign the final bundle using the plugin author key shown below.

rollout seal: bky4_x7Gc

Heads of department were briefed on the ongoing dispute concerning the Veltrix licensing agreement. Counsel reported that Quenmark Systems maintains its interpretation of the renewal clause, and mediation is scheduled for next month. In the interim, departments should continue using Veltrix under existing terms and route any related correspondence through legal. Mr. Havelin will provide weekly updates. The strategic considerations informing our negotiating position are set out in the confidential note below.

confidential, kagep-kahof: Druokax Systems plans to lower the Ulaath list price by 53 percent in March.